Written Answers. - Appropriations-in-Aid.

Richard Bruton

Question:

188 Mr. R. Bruton asked the Minister for Community, Rural and Gaeltacht Affairs the details of the appropriation-in-aid raised by his Department in 2000 and 2001; his estimate for the outturn for 2002; and the percentage yearly increase in each subhead. [18719/02]

The following table shows the Department of Arts, Heritage, Gaeltacht and the Islands appropriation-in-aid outturn for 2000 and 2001 and the percentage increase in each subhead:

As the Deputy will be aware the Department of Community, Rural and Gaeltacht Affairs was set up during 2002 and our receipts for this year will be made up of amounts relevant to Department of Arts, Heritage, Gaeltacht and the Islands for the early part of the year and for the new Department thereafter. Thus the projected total of €64,482,000 for 2002 does not bear comparison with the previous two years, given the impact of the charges in departmental functions on the appropriation-in-aid.
